Abstract:Yishu fault is a large scale active fault. It is the largest earth quake activity belt in eastern China. Regional geological survey with the scale of 1∶ 50000 has been carried out in northern Weifang. 2 Holocene faults have been found in Yujiashanxia and Tianzhuang. Its distribution, occurrence, characteristics, activity time and its relationship with shallow earthquake have been studied. It is showed that the Holocene faults are normal faults formed under the action of tension. It has the same characteristics with the faults in bedrock areas. It is regarded that AnqiuJuxian fault and Tangwu Gegou fault have obvious inheritance or derivative relations. At the same time, based on the fact that faults cut through late Pleistocene Dazhan group, Holocene Heituhu group and Baiyunhu group, and covered with artificial deposits, it is determined that fault formation time is in about 2.1Ka, and has good correlation with seismic activity. The discovery of Holocene faults in northern section of Yishu fault zone has important significance to study the Neotectonic movement and seismic hazard assessment in southern Laizhou Bay.
